news 2026/7/1 20:13:01

At.js 终极使用指南:轻松实现智能提及功能

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
At.js 终极使用指南:轻松实现智能提及功能

At.js 终极使用指南:轻松实现智能提及功能

【免费下载链接】At.jsAdd Github like mentions autocomplete to your application.项目地址: https://gitcode.com/gh_mirrors/at/At.js

At.js 是一个功能强大的 jQuery 插件,能够为你的应用程序添加类似 GitHub 的智能提及自动完成功能。在前100字的介绍中,我们明确提到 At.js 的核心功能是智能提及自动完成,这正是用户最关注的功能点。通过本指南,你将学会如何快速集成和使用这个强大的工具。

🚀 为什么选择 At.js 智能提及插件

At.js 智能提及功能为现代 Web 应用提供了出色的用户体验。无论是在社交媒体平台、团队协作工具还是内容管理系统中,智能提及功能都能显著提升用户的交互效率。

核心优势:

  • 轻量级设计,不影响页面性能
  • 高度可定制,适应各种场景需求
  • 支持多种输入框类型
  • 提供丰富的配置选项

📋 快速开始:5分钟完成集成

环境准备与安装

首先需要克隆项目仓库并安装依赖:

git clone https://gitcode.com/gh_mirrors/at/At.js cd At.js npm install

基本配置步骤

  1. 引入必要文件

    • jQuery 库
    • At.js 核心文件
    • 样式文件 src/jquery.atwho.css
  2. 初始化插件

    $('input').atwho({ at: "@", data: ['Jacob', 'Joshua', 'Jayden'] })
  3. 自定义配置根据你的具体需求调整配置参数,如触发字符、数据源、显示模板等。

🎯 高级功能详解

数据源配置

At.js 支持多种数据源类型:

  • 静态数组数据
  • 远程 API 接口
  • 动态过滤数据

事件处理机制

插件提供了完整的事件系统,包括:

  • 输入触发事件
  • 选择完成事件
  • 列表显示/隐藏事件

🔧 实战应用场景

社交媒体平台

在评论系统、消息发送等场景中,At.js 能够快速定位并提示用户提及的对象,大大提升交互效率。

团队协作工具

在项目管理、团队沟通等应用中,智能提及功能帮助用户快速@团队成员,确保信息准确传达。

💡 最佳实践建议

性能优化:

  • 合理设置数据缓存
  • 控制下拉列表显示数量
  • 优化远程请求频率

用户体验:

  • 提供清晰的视觉反馈
  • 支持键盘导航操作
  • 确保移动端兼容性

🛠️ 故障排除指南

当遇到问题时,可以按照以下步骤排查:

  1. 检查 jQuery 是否正确加载
  2. 确认初始化配置参数
  3. 验证数据源格式
  4. 检查 CSS 样式冲突

📚 扩展学习资源

想要深入了解 At.js 的更多功能?建议查看项目中的示例文件:

  • examples/hashtags.html - 标签提及示例
  • examples/medium-editor.html - 富文本编辑器集成
  • examples/tinyMCE.html - TinyMCE 集成案例

通过遵循本指南,你将能够轻松掌握 At.js 的使用技巧,为你的应用程序添加强大的智能提及功能。记住,好的用户体验来自于对细节的关注和不断的优化改进。

【免费下载链接】At.jsAdd Github like mentions autocomplete to your application.项目地址: https://gitcode.com/gh_mirrors/at/At.js

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/7/1 6:44:20

ProxyPool多环境配置策略与性能优化实践

问题背景与挑战分析 【免费下载链接】ProxyPool An Efficient ProxyPool with Getter, Tester and Server 项目地址: https://gitcode.com/gh_mirrors/pr/ProxyPool 在现代分布式系统中,代理池作为网络请求的重要基础设施,其配置策略直接影响系统…

作者头像 李华
网站建设 2026/7/1 0:47:22

Spider-flow权限控制与数据加密实战指南:轻松配置企业级安全防护

Spider-flow权限控制与数据加密实战指南:轻松配置企业级安全防护 【免费下载链接】spider-flow 新一代爬虫平台,以图形化方式定义爬虫流程,不写代码即可完成爬虫。 项目地址: https://gitcode.com/gh_mirrors/sp/spider-flow 当你使用…

作者头像 李华
网站建设 2026/6/25 7:21:08

Unity编辑器革命:Odin Inspector中文教程深度解析

Unity编辑器革命:Odin Inspector中文教程深度解析 【免费下载链接】Odin-Inspector-Chinese-Tutorial 中文教程 项目地址: https://gitcode.com/gh_mirrors/od/Odin-Inspector-Chinese-Tutorial 为什么选择Odin Inspector? 在Unity开发过程中&am…

作者头像 李华
网站建设 2026/7/1 20:12:33

5步掌握Git-Stats:打造本地Git贡献日历的终极指南

5步掌握Git-Stats:打造本地Git贡献日历的终极指南 【免费下载链接】git-stats 🍀 Local git statistics including GitHub-like contributions calendars. 项目地址: https://gitcode.com/gh_mirrors/gi/git-stats 想要像GitHub那样直观查看你的代…

作者头像 李华
网站建设 2026/6/30 22:32:36

TiDB物化视图技术深度解析:实现10倍查询性能优化

TiDB物化视图技术深度解析:实现10倍查询性能优化 【免费下载链接】tidb TiDB 是一个分布式关系型数据库,兼容 MySQL 协议。* 提供水平扩展能力;支持高并发、高可用、在线 DDL 等特性。* 特点:分布式架构设计;支持 MySQ…

作者头像 李华